Class Hierarchy
- java.lang.Object
- org.keycloak.authentication.AbstractFormAuthenticator (implements org.keycloak.authentication.Authenticator)
- org.keycloak.authentication.AuthenticationProcessor
- org.keycloak.authentication.AuthenticationProcessor.Result (implements org.keycloak.authentication.AuthenticationFlowContext, org.keycloak.authentication.ClientAuthenticationFlowContext)
- org.keycloak.authentication.AuthenticationSelectionOption
- org.keycloak.authentication.AuthenticatorSpi (implements org.keycloak.provider.Spi)
- org.keycloak.authentication.AuthenticatorUtil
- org.keycloak.authentication.ClientAuthenticationFlow (implements org.keycloak.authentication.AuthenticationFlow)
- org.keycloak.authentication.ClientAuthenticatorSpi (implements org.keycloak.provider.Spi)
- org.keycloak.authentication.DefaultAuthenticationFlow (implements org.keycloak.authentication.AuthenticationFlow)
- org.keycloak.authentication.FormActionSpi (implements org.keycloak.provider.Spi)
- org.keycloak.authentication.FormAuthenticationFlow (implements org.keycloak.authentication.AuthenticationFlow)
- org.keycloak.authentication.FormAuthenticatorSpi (implements org.keycloak.provider.Spi)
- org.keycloak.authentication.RequiredActionContextResult (implements org.keycloak.authentication.RequiredActionContext)
- org.keycloak.authentication.RequiredActionSpi (implements org.keycloak.provider.Spi)
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- java.lang.RuntimeException
- org.keycloak.authentication.AuthenticationFlowException
- org.keycloak.authentication.ForkFlowException
- org.keycloak.authentication.AuthenticationFlowException
- org.keycloak.common.VerificationException
- org.keycloak.authentication.ExplainedVerificationException
- java.lang.RuntimeException
- java.lang.Exception
Interface Hierarchy
- org.keycloak.authentication.AbstractAuthenticationFlowContext
- org.keycloak.authentication.AuthenticationFlowContext
- org.keycloak.authentication.ClientAuthenticationFlowContext
- org.keycloak.authentication.AuthenticationFlow
- org.keycloak.provider.ConfiguredProvider
- org.keycloak.authentication.ConfigurableAuthenticatorFactory
- org.keycloak.authentication.AuthenticatorFactory (also extends org.keycloak.provider.ProviderFactory<T>)
- org.keycloak.authentication.AuthenticationFlowCallbackFactory
- org.keycloak.authentication.ClientAuthenticatorFactory (also extends org.keycloak.provider.ProviderFactory<T>)
- org.keycloak.authentication.FormActionFactory (also extends org.keycloak.provider.ProviderFactory<T>)
- org.keycloak.authentication.FormAuthenticatorFactory (also extends org.keycloak.provider.ProviderFactory<T>)
- org.keycloak.authentication.AuthenticatorFactory (also extends org.keycloak.provider.ProviderFactory<T>)
- org.keycloak.authentication.ConfigurableAuthenticatorFactory
- org.keycloak.authentication.CredentialAction
- org.keycloak.authentication.CredentialRegistrator
- org.keycloak.authentication.CredentialValidator<T>
- org.keycloak.authentication.FormContext
- org.keycloak.authentication.ValidationContext
- org.keycloak.provider.Provider
- org.keycloak.authentication.Authenticator
- org.keycloak.authentication.AuthenticationFlowCallback
- org.keycloak.authentication.ClientAuthenticator
- org.keycloak.authentication.FormAction
- org.keycloak.authentication.FormAuthenticator
- org.keycloak.authentication.RequiredActionProvider
- org.keycloak.authentication.Authenticator
- org.keycloak.provider.ProviderFactory<T>
- org.keycloak.authentication.AuthenticatorFactory (also extends org.keycloak.authentication.ConfigurableAuthenticatorFactory)
- org.keycloak.authentication.AuthenticationFlowCallbackFactory
- org.keycloak.authentication.ClientAuthenticatorFactory (also extends org.keycloak.authentication.ConfigurableAuthenticatorFactory)
- org.keycloak.authentication.FormActionFactory (also extends org.keycloak.authentication.ConfigurableAuthenticatorFactory)
- org.keycloak.authentication.FormAuthenticatorFactory (also extends org.keycloak.authentication.ConfigurableAuthenticatorFactory)
- org.keycloak.authentication.RequiredActionFactory
- org.keycloak.authentication.AuthenticatorFactory (also extends org.keycloak.authentication.ConfigurableAuthenticatorFactory)
- org.keycloak.authentication.RequiredActionContext
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- org.keycloak.authentication.AuthenticationFlowError
- org.keycloak.authentication.FlowStatus
- org.keycloak.authentication.InitiatedActionSupport
- org.keycloak.authentication.RequiredActionContext.KcActionStatus
- org.keycloak.authentication.RequiredActionContext.Status
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)